1979 - 1983 Santec's Early Years - Pioneering Innovation
Evolving from its start as an importer/distributor of fine ceramic materials, and then as a CAD/CAM solution provider, Santec has achieved a significant transformation by establishing itself as a premier developer of optical technology.

Established in 1979 as Samcom Electric Inc. in Nagoya City, our primary business was to develop and import fine ceramic materials for use in glass fiber, ceramic fiber, IC packages, etc. We established OPELS Corp. as a subsidiary to develop and sell office-automation software in 1981. In 1983 Samcom changed its name to Santec Corporation to focus on a new fiber-optic line of business and R&D.

1984 - 1989 Santec's New Niche: Optical Technology Pioneer
Santec drew considerable industry attention through the achievements of this period, and its original products soon became essential tools in several related fields of research. This period culminates with our construction of our Photonics Laboratory in 1989.

Notable innovations:

The world's first optical-fiber mode-field-parameter test system-the FTS-2000 (sold to leading manufacturers of fiber-optic cables)
Ultra-high-resolution laser spectrum line-width analyzer developed jointly with KDD R&D Laboratories
The world's first polarization-mode-dispersion characteristics analyzer
Ferrule/die measuring instrument (Micro Hole Meter)
Laser-diode controller
Frequency-stabilized LD light source
Narrow-spectrum LD light source
Broadband tunable-wavelength LD light source
Tunable Semiconductor Laser System, TSL-80

1990 - 1997 Santec's Cultivation of Technologies: The Dawn of the Optical Component Business
Following the bursting of Japan's economic bubble, Santec aggregated its accumulated technologies and know-how in order to leverage innovations in the overall process of research and development.
We began developing optical components based on proprietary Multi-Layer Dielectric Interference Filter technology to produce a line of "second-batch products" that established our base in a completely different field of business in new markets such as production facilities and construction sites. During this period we introduced a series of successful experiments in high-speed Gbps network technology. Santec supplied the measuring instruments and optical components that are now recognized as essential to the accelerated construction and use of undersea cable.

Notable innovations:

Optical-amplifier evaluation system and ultra-high-speed pulse generator
HRS-2200, an image processing system for FA application
OPELS optical hyper system series, incorporating modular technology (included the broadband tunable-wavelength LD light source)
Polarization-independent tunable-wavelength optical filter
Compact tunable-wavelength light source
Tunable optical attenuator
Simplified wavemeter

1998 - Present Santec's Rapid Growth in WDM Technology and Optical Components
Santec's Enhanced System of Quality Assurance developed in the most recent period has produced three core businesses: Optical Components, Tunable-Wavelength Lasers and Optical Measuring Instruments.

The explosive growth of the Internet in the late 1990s served to speed the full-scale implementation of large-capacity, high-speed optical communication networks. The development of Wavelength Division Multiplexing (WDM) technology generated an even greater demand for key optical devices, and helped transform our optical components from mere research tools to practical devices offering quality sufficient to withstand the rigors of real-world use.

During this period we obtained an ISO 9001 certification and became recognized worldwide as a force in the realm of communications technology. Santec's products passed quality audits by Lucent Technologies, CIENA, Ericsson and others, and were incorporated in transmission devices by many of the world's most prominent manufacturers.

Corporate milestones:

Relocated the office of Santec USA to Hackensack, New Jersey and opened Santec Europe in Oxford, U.K.
Completed the construction of Santec Photonics Laboratory in Komaki/Nagoya (Tower C).
Established a tri-polar R&D infrastructure encompassing Japan, the U.S. and Europe.
Listed shares on Nasdaq Japan operated by Osaka Securities Exchange Co., Ltd.
Completed Phase II of Photonics Valley Ohkusa Campus (Tower D and E).
Opened Santec China in Shanghai.

World's first products from Santec
Optical Fiber Geometry Test System, 1984
PMD Analyzer, 1985
Bench Top Laser Diode Driver, 1986
Bench Top Tunable Laser Source, 1987
Linear Slider Tunable Filter, 1996
Optical Delay Line Module, 1997
Wavelength Locker, 1997
Motorized VOA, 1998
Integrated Tap PD, 2001
Mini Digital IPD, 2002
